Urban district in South Central Coast, Vietnam
Cẩm Lệ is an urban district of Da Nang in the South Central Coast region of Vietnam.
Administration
The district was established by Government Decree No. 102/2005/ND-CP on August 5, 2005.
The district includes six urban wards (phường):
- Khuê Trung
- Hòa Thọ Đông
- Hòa Thọ Tây
- Hòa An
- Hòa Phát
- Hòa Xuân
As of 2003 the district had a population of 71,429.[1] The district covers an area of 33.3 km². The district capital lies at Hòa Thọ Đông ward.[1]
